Shawnee had won two straight games and Karleigh Hutchins did her part to make it three on Thursday. The Indians blew past the Van Wert Cougars 3-0 with plenty of help from Hutchins, who had 12 aces, ten digs, and eight kills. She is on a roll when it comes to kills, as she's now had eight or more in each of the last three games she's played.

The 3-0 score doesn't show just how dominant Shawnee was: they took every set by at least 13 points. The final score came out to 25-6, 25-12, 25-5.

Shawnee was led to victory by Chelsea Burkholder and Sami Rettig. Burkholder had 21 assists and four digs, while Rettig had eight digs and two aces.

They weren't the only good servers: Shawnee was lethal from the service line and finished the match with 23 aces. That's the most aces they've managed all season.

Shawnee's win bumped their record up to 14-5. As for Van Wert,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 1-18.

Shawnee has already played their next matchup, a 3-0 victory against Ottawa-Glandorf on the 7th. As for Van Wert,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next match, a 3-0 loss against Waynesfield-Goshen on the 4th.
